DotClear - Guide d'utilisation
1. Installation
1.1. Pré-requis
DotClear fonctionne chez les hébergeurs supportant PHP 4.1 minimum et MySQL.
Aucun module particulier n'est nécessaire. Les fonctions utf8_encode et
utf8_decode doivent être présentes.
1.2. Installation
Téléchargez DotClear et décompressez l'archive où bon vous semble.
1.2.1. Configuration générale
Ouvrez le fichier conf/config.php et renseignez les paramètres de
connexion à MySQL :
- $dbuser : nom de l'utilisateur se connectant à MySQL (généralement
votre login).
- $dbpass : votre mot de passe pour se connecter à la base.
- $dbhost : nom de la machine hébergeant la base MySQL (consultez
votre hébergeur).
- $dbbase : nom de la base de données où sera installé DotClear.
- $dbprefix : préfixe ajouté devant le nom de chaque table.
Vous pouvez également modifier le paramètre $max_upload_size qui
permet de limiter la taille maximum des fichiers envoyés depuis l'interface
d'administration. Notez que vous ne pourrez dépasser la valeur maximum autorisée
par votre hébergeur.
1.2.2. Mise en route
Chargez les fichiers sur votre espace Web si ce n'est déjà fait.
Lancez ensuite le script ecrire/install.php.
Si aucune erreur ne s'est produite, il ne vous reste plus qu'à vous connecter
sur votre interface d'administration pour commencer votre blogue. Sinon vous
pouvez crier et éventuellement chercher ce qui ne va pas dans votre
configuration.
1.3. Configuration post-installation
Une fois votre blogue prêt à fonctionner, vous pouvez commencer par le
configurer de manière plus fine. Deux options s'offrent à vous. Si vous êtes à l'aise
avec l'édition de fichiers de configuration, vous pouvez directement éditer le
fichier conf/blog_conf.php. Sinon, vous pouvez utiliser
l'outil de configuration disponible depuis l'onglet outils. Cliquez
simplement sur Configuration de DotClear pour accéder à cet outil.
Note
Le fichier conf/blog_conf.php doit
être accessible en écriture par votre serveur pour utiliser la configuration
par l'interface d'administration. Un avertissement vous sera donné le cas échéant.
Dans les deux cas, voici ce à quoi correspond chaque option :
- Nom du blogue
- Le nom de votre blogue. Celui-ci sera utilisé dans le fil RSS, sur la page
d'accueil et lors des communications automatiques avec d'autres sites
(trackbacks ou pings).
- URL vers le blogue
- L'URL pour accéder à la page d'accueil de votre blogue depuis la raçine de
votre site. Par exemple, si votre site est http://www.foo.tld et que
votre blogue se trouve à http://www.foo.tld/index.php, vous donnerez
/index.php/. Notez que les slash (/) sont importants au début comme
à la fin.
- Emplacement des images
- Définit l'emplacement de vos images. Comme pour l'URL vers le blogue, cette
valeur s'exprime depuis la raçine de votre site. Par exemple /dotclear/images
si vos images sont dans http://www.foo.tld/dotclear/images/.
- Thème
- Une liste de thèmes vous est proposée. Par défaut vous n'en avez qu'un mais
pouvez en télécharger depuis le site de
DotClear.
- Nombre de billets par page
- Indique le nombre de billets sur la première page du blogue et chaque
première page de catégorie.
- Permettre les commentaires
- Permettre ou non les commentaires. Notez que le simple fait de supprimer
les commentaires du template ne les désactive pas, un petit malin pourrait
en poster quand même. Cette option à non rendra impossible l'envoi
de commentaire.
- Permettre les trackbacks
- Mêmes remarques que pour les commentaires.
- Commentaires au format Wiki
- Si cette option est active, les commentaires entrés seront au format
Wiki. Notez que l'aide n'est pas affichée dans le template par défaut.
- Notification des commentaires par email
- Cette option permet d'activer l'envoi d'un email pour chaque commentaire
ajouté sur votre blogue. Il est nécessaire d'indiquer une adresse email dans
les préférences de l'utilisateur pour que cette fonctionnalité soit acive. Notez
enfin que certains hébergeurs bloquent l'envoi d'email.
- Afficher des émoticones
- Afficher ou non des émoticones (images expressives) dans les
billets et les commentaires.
- Format de la date
- Format de la date des billets et du calendrier selon les masques de la fonction PHP strftime.
- Format de l'heure
- Format de l'heure des billets selon les masques de la fonction PHP strftime.